Health is a Human Right: UHC Day

Over a 100 million people worldwide are pushed into extreme poverty paying for health services every year. That’s 100 million too many. International Universal Health Coverage Day (UHC Day) aims to mobilise diverse stakeholders to call for stronger, more equitable health systems to achieve universal health coverage, leaving no one behind. Unlocking the Past

Unlocking the Past: A Guide to the Australian College of Nursing Archival Collection is a 38-page booklet detailing the contents of the ACN archival collection. Those interested in the history of nursing in Australia and our professional organisation will find the booklet a handy accompaniment to aid their research using the archival collection.
